# SpringBoot-CRM客户关系管理系统 **Repository Path**: howstrong/crm-system ## Basic Information - **Project Name**: SpringBoot-CRM客户关系管理系统 - **Description**: .SpringBoot-CRM客户关系管理系统 - **Primary Language**: Java - **License**: MulanPSL-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 19 - **Forks**: 4 - **Created**: 2024-10-17 - **Last Updated**: 2025-06-23 ## Categories & Tags **Categories**: Uncategorized **Tags**: SpringBoot, Java, 管理系统 ## README # CRM客户关系管理系统 - 后端:https://gitee.com/howstrong/crm-system - 前端:https://gitee.com/howstrong/crm-vue #### 介绍 CRM系统,即客户关系管理系统(Customer Relationship Management System),是一种用于管理企业与客户之间互动的技术解决方案。它旨在提高客户满意度、优化客户体验、提高客户忠诚度,并最终推动销售增长和利润提升。CRM系统可以包括以下功能: 1. **客户数据管理**:收集和整理客户的基本信息、购买历史、偏好设置等数据。 2. **销售管理**:跟踪销售机会、销售漏斗、报价、订单和回款情况。 3. **市场营销自动化**:设计和执行市场营销活动,包括电子邮件营销、社交媒体营销和目标广告。 4. **客户服务和支持**:提供客户服务跟踪、故障单管理、自助服务门户和知识库。 5. **客户反馈收集**:通过调查问卷、客户反馈表和社交媒体监听等方式收集客户反馈。 6. **报告和分析**:生成销售报告、客户分析报告和市场趋势报告,帮助企业做出数据驱动的决策。 #### 项目环境 **前端** 软件:Vscode(推荐) 环境:Node 版本 16 或者 18(推荐) **注:千万别选 18 以上的版本!** **后端** 软件:IDEA(推荐) 环境:MySQL 5.7 或者 8.0(推荐)Redis(可选) JDK8或JDK11 Maven3.6.x #### 安装教程 ##### **运行后端代码** **运行准备** (1)导入项目 (clean / install) (2)导入sql文件 (3)修改application-durid.yml (改成你自己的url 、 用户名 、 密码) **项目启动:** - 启动huike-admin工程的HuiKeApplication.class的main方法 **注意:** ```xml 1.18.20 ``` ##### 运行前端代码 **使用nginx启动:** 参考资料: ![image-20220419175256688](assets/image-20220419175256688.png) - 1.解压到非中文路径; - 2.双击nginx.exe运行即可; - 3.访问 http://localhost:8088/ (nginx.conf 配置文件已指定监听端口8088, 反向代理等配置) ```sh # ******* winndows下Nginx的启动、停止等命令: ****** # 1、启动: 双击exe 或者 start nginx # 2、停止: nginx.exe -s stop nginx.exe -s quit #注:stop是快速停止nginx,可能并不保存相关信息;quit是完整有序的停止nginx,并保存相关信息。 # 3、重新载入Nginx: 当配置信息修改,需要重新载入这些配置时使用此命令。 nginx.exe -s reload ``` #### 使用说明 CRM专业术语解释 ``` 线索:销售线索是与客户初次接触获得的原始信息,可以是从民会中获得的名片,通过推广活动获得的毛话号码,或是会议、广告、外部购买等渠道获得的客户简单信息,然后通过管理和跟进可以转化为商机 线索池:跟进后,没有转化成商机的线索集合,可以理解为线索回收站 商机:商机是从意向客户到成交客戶的跟进过程,最后的通过签订合同,转变水成交客戶 公海池:己跟进,但未成功转化的潜在客户,可以理解为潜在客户的回收站 客广:本系统内的客户是指成功签订合同的客户,由商机转化而来 合同:合同是销售过程中的一个重要组成部分,表示客户己成交的矣键步骤。 转派:系统中用户离职,产生的线索、商机的重新分配任买 ``` ![](assets/777402fa5aa24eb859dbb15d0ec878d.png) 核心模块有线索管理,商机管理,合同管理,转派管理,系统管理 其中线索管理主要的功能是:查看线索相关的信息,分页展示所有的线索,可以进行线索的查看,分配,线索的创建和导入等 ![](assets/f9ee34cc187b08d9cd103b6b699d71e.png) 可以看到线索的数据来源有两个一个是人工录入即添加线索的方式,还有一个就是批量导入的方式 查看按钮可以查看具体的线索的内容 商机管理: ![](assets/660a98ca979a66fdd20e46040a5396e.png) 通过产品原型可以看到商机相关的信息,分页展示所有的商机,可以进行商机的查看,分配,商机的创建 合同管理: ![](assets/766504d0f1ef5b044e00c937ee819cc.png) 合同管理可以看到合同相关的信息,分页展示所有的合同,可以进行合同的查看和添加 #### 参与贡献 1. Fork 本仓库 2. 新建 Feat_xxx 分支 3. 提交代码 4. 新建 Pull Request #### 特技 1. 使用 Readme\_XXX.md 来支持不同的语言,例如 Readme\_en.md, Readme\_zh.md 2. Gitee 官方博客 [blog.gitee.com](https://blog.gitee.com) 3. 你可以 [https://gitee.com/explore](https://gitee.com/explore) 这个地址来了解 Gitee 上的优秀开源项目 4. [GVP](https://gitee.com/gvp) 全称是 Gitee 最有价值开源项目,是综合评定出的优秀开源项目 5. Gitee 官方提供的使用手册 [https://gitee.com/help](https://gitee.com/help) 6. Gitee 封面人物是一档用来展示 Gitee 会员风采的栏目 [https://gitee.com/gitee-stars/](https://gitee.com/gitee-stars/)